Three Penn State Football Players Make Annual Freaks List

If you want to win in college football, you better have some freaks.
Every year, Bruce Feldman compiles a list of college football’s biggest, strongest, and most mobile players to highlight those who have put in the work over the summer.
This season, Penn State had three players on the list: Linebacker Tony Rojas at No. 25, wide receiver Brett Eskildsen at No. 35, and cornerback Audavion Collins at No. 91.
Rojas was credited with his elite speed and explosiveness after clocking a 4.37 40 last offseason, along with a 10-5 broad jump and a 22.5 mph GPS speed.
He is coming off a season where he had 25 tackles, 4.5 TFLs, and two sacks in four games, but missed most of the year with a season-ending torn ACL.
Eskildsen was listed at No. 35 for similar reasons.
“Matt Campbell brought some terrific players with him from Ames. Eskildsen, a 6-1, 205-pound wideout who caught 30 passes for 526 yards and five TDs last season, is one of them,” Feldman wrote.
“The former high school track star was one of the Big 12’s top big-play men in 2025, averaging 17.5 yards per reception (second-best in the Big 12). Eskildsen vertical jumped 40 inches this offseason to go with an 11-foot broad jump and a 325-pound bench press, and he also hit 23.1 mph on the GPS.”
At No. 91, cornerback Audavion Collins is another Nittany Lions speedster on the list.
According to Matt Campbell, Collins hit 23.5 mph on the GPS this offseason and recorded a 38-inch vertical jump and a 305-pound bench press.
Collins was one of the impact returners for the Nittany Lions this season, after starting all 13 games in 2025, totaling 47 tackles (33 solo), 2.5 tackles for loss, one fumble recovery, and three pass breakups.
“I don’t know what these guys are on the clock, but if they race, nobody’s faster than AC,” Terry Smith said. “He’s the ultimate competitor. He’s as fast as what’s running against him. AC has that different gear. It’s uniquely different.”
Former Penn State quarterback Beau Pribula also made the list, except this time as a Virginia Cavalier.
